Belinda has specialised in media law for over 20 years, including five years as a partner at Goodman Derrick where she is now a consultant.
In her media law practice, she deals with all aspects of non-contentious and compliance work relating to television content and broadcasting. She also advises on a wide variety of media law matters including: defamation, contempt, copyright and breach of confidence.
Belinda has extensive experience of television current affairs and documentary, and has worked as a programme lawyer within ITV Compliance. She has also spent time on secondment at a major advertising agency as acting General Counsel.
